This program is suited for students and beginners in land surveying. The program is heavily tilted towards field-based practice and will equip the learners to become operator-ready.
The key takeaways from the program are:
 |
Explain fundamental measurement concepts using Total Station Surveying |
 |
Define rectangular and polar coordinate systems |
 |
Explain the principles of electronic distance measurement |
 |
Explain the working principles of Total Station |
 |
Perform topological survey |
 |
Describe land survey terminologies |
 |
Perform and record land survey measurements |
 |
Explain stakeout and alignment concepts |
 |
Measure remote distance and elevation using special function of Total Station |
 |
Calculate area on the field (2D, 3D) and surface volume |
 |
Perform onsite instrument calibration |
 |
Explain and demonstrate the procedure for download and upload of data in Total Station |
 |
Define the Total Station data formats |
 |
Transfer data from TS to AutoCAD |
